Other interesting facts about my history, in case you want to know more:

I am an author, speaker, workshop creator, mentor and consultant. I’ve seen the best and the worst of business In my career.  I have coached over 500 executives and leaders, all who have had a huge impact on the lives of their teams, companies, and communities they serve.  In my career, I have contributed to the growth and development of many "small but mighty"​ businesses and cities in Washington, Oregon, California, Arizona, and Vancouver, BC through mentorship and creatively connecting people in my network. Some of my more notable clients include:  Tommy Bahama, Coinstar, Microsoft, The Audubon Society, Ads Inc., American Ninja Warrior Producers, City of Mercer Island, WA, City of Woodinville, WA, City of Shoreline, WA, City of Tustin, CA and hundreds of small businesses who wanted to grow in the most effective ways possible.


I am a Master Certified Trainer for Mindvalley, Inc. (www.mindvalley.com) and Clarity International (www.getclarity.com), who both produce workshops all around the world in living life on purpose and getting more out of every single day!  I get great joy out of creating self-awareness experiences for individuals and groups who desire more satisfaction and conscious practices in their lives.


I  have taught Entrepreneurship at the University of Washington, Seattle University , Lake Washington Technical College, Bellevue College, and a wide variety of high school classrooms across America.  Because I just couldn’t get enough of the entrepreneurial life, I supported several start-up incubators in the Seattle area, and led the Start-up America effort in Washington State.  In 2019 I moved to Florida full-time and have begun the efforts to enrich the entrepreneurial ecosystem in my new home state as well.  I have spent countless hours with entrepreneurs and leaders in communities who truly want to change the world--and I am excited to see where we go in 2023!
